"Side Scape" is a great little indie-title with a unique mechanic (switch instanly between 2D platformer and Top-Down Zelda-like) that is implemented very well (after you get used to the perspective switch). Storywise you play two heroes from different dimensions merged together in their quest to undo this: it really taps into meta-narrative, but keeps it's light tone and is solid throughout. Pixelart and spritework are a bit on the amateurish side, sound is okayish and combat with the knight can be a little wonky in early game, but the unique premise and the charming, if rough package should get more recognition! A definite recommendation for everyone who looks for a new Zelda-like of old!

A pretty neat game! The powerups you find are pretty interesting, and having two characters with their own abilities and health bars adds an extra layer of strategy to boss fights that I think's pretty cool! The top-down combat can feel a little stiff at times, though later powerups I found helped a lot. (And also I play a lot of platformers so I'm just generally not as practiced at top-down combat, so that's probably a factor too.) [spoiler] I spent quite a while trying to defeat the dragon thing boss with Grisham before finally using the knight and realizing it was way easier since I could just use the shield to knock back the projectiles and stun it. Which makes complete sense given that thing is the final boss of the knight's world, so of course it would be designed around his abilities! [/spoiler] The music's neat too! It's a pretty cool game, and I enjoyed it!
